The Play (Briar U, Book 3) follows , the charming, energetic, and newly appointed captain of the Briar University hockey team. After a disastrous previous season where distractions—mostly of the romantic variety—cost his team the championship, Hunter makes a desperate vow: no more screwing up, and no more screwing, period.
